NTT Security Acquires WhiteHat Security

ntt securityTokyo, Japan-based security company NTT Security Corporation is to acquire WhiteHat Security, a San Jose, CA-based application security provider committed to securing applications that run enterprises’ businesses.

The amount of the deal was not disclosed.

The acquisition positions NTT Security as one of the most comprehensive pure-play cybersecurity services companies. Post-acquisition, WhiteHat Security will operate as an independent, wholly-owned subsidiary of NTT Security Corporation.
The deal expands NTT Security’s portfolio, allowing its customers and partners to benefit from WhiteHat Security’s cloud-based Application Security Platform. WhiteHat’s customers and partners will have access to NTT Security’s consulting and advisory services, along with their next-generation platform based Managed Security Services.

Craig Hinkley, CEO, WhiteHat Security provides developers with tools and services to write and deliver secure software at speed. The WhiteHat Application Security Platform is empowering DevSecOps by continuously assessing the risk for organizations’ software assets and helping them to embed security throughout the software life cycle (SLC).
The company also has regional offices across the U.S. and Europe.

Led by Katsumi Nakata, Chief Executive Officer, NTT Security is the specialized security company for NTT Group. With embedded security, it enables NTT Group companies to deliver resilient business solutions for clients’ digital transformation needs. The company has 10 Security Operations Centers (SOCs), seven R&D centers, over 1,500 security experts and handles hundreds of thousands of security incidents annually across six continents.
